Style Guide Development

Companies that operate internationally need to ensure consistent verbal and visual communication in all countries and languages. CLS can help you by developing corporate wording and design guidelines for the people in your organization to follow. These style guides define the nitty-gritty aspects of the language that are often glossed over, but need to be tackled. For instance, does your firm write currency amounts with 'CHF' or 'SFr' as an abbreviation for Swiss francs? CLS terminologists work with you to draw up transparent and comprehensive guidelines.

Your staff benefit from a useful reference work that defines the formal aspects of communication in all languages, from how currencies are written to the format used for telephone numbers. Our clients are often very keen to avoid certain wording or formats for legal reasons, and a style guide can provide hard and fast rules to that end.
